General info

Function

Polycomb group (PcG) protein. Component of the PRC2 complex, which methylates 'Lys-9' (H3K9me) and 'Lys-27' (H3K27me) of histone H3, leading to transcriptional repression of the affected target gene (PubMed:15225548, PubMed:15231737, PubMed:15385962, PubMed:16618801, PubMed:17344414, PubMed:18285464, PubMed:28229514, PubMed:29499137, PubMed:31959557). The PRC2 complex may also serve as a recruiting platform for DNA methyltransferases, thereby linking two epigenetic repression systems (PubMed:12351676, PubMed:12435631, PubMed:15099518, PubMed:15225548, PubMed:15385962, PubMed:15684044, PubMed:16431907, PubMed:18086877, PubMed:18285464). Genes repressed by the PRC2 complex include HOXC8, HOXA9, MYT1 and CDKN2A (PubMed:15231737, PubMed:16618801, PubMed:17200670, PubMed:31959557).

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the VEFS (VRN2-EMF2-FIS2-SU(Z)12) family.

Post-translational modifications

Sumoylated, probably by PIAS2.

Subcellular localisation
Nucleus

Activity summary

The target EZH2 + SUZ12 + RbAp48 forms a core part of the Polycomb Repressive Complex 2 (PRC2). EZH2 also known as Enhancer of Zeste Homolog 2 is a histone methyltransferase enzyme with a mass of about 85-97 kDa depending on isoforms and post-translational modifications. SUZ12 (Suppressor of Zeste 12 protein homolog) and RbAp48 (Retinoblastoma Binding Protein 4) work with EZH2 to regulate gene expression. Together they contribute to the trimethylation of histone H3 on lysine 27 (H3K27me3) silencing target genes. The expression of this complex varies but is often found in stem cells cancer cells and tissues undergoing rapid division.

Biological function summary

EZH2 SUZ12 and RbAp48 are significant in regulating gene expression through chromatin modification as part of the PRC2 complex. The complex plays a role in maintaining stem cell pluripotency and proper differentiation by stably repressing the transcription of specific gene sets. SUZ12 and RbAp48 stabilize the structure of the PRC2 complex facilitating the gene silencing activity of EZH2. Their activity highlights developmental processes such as cellular differentiation and proliferation.

Pathways

EZH2 + SUZ12 + RbAp48 heavily influence the Wnt signaling and Notch signaling pathways. In the Wnt pathway EZH2 can repress antagonists of Wnt signals modulating cellular responses. In the Notch pathway PRC2 helps in the transcriptional repression required for cellular differentiation. Proteins such as Beta-catenin in the Wnt pathway and Notch receptors in the Notch pathway are often interlinked with the regulatory functions of this complex.

Associated diseases and disorders

EZH2 aberrations are closely associated with cancers and developmental disorders. Overexpression or mutations in EZH2 are linked with tumorigenesis especially in prostate cancer and lymphomas. In developmental disorders mutations in SUZ12 or depletion of RbAp48 may cause syndromes characterized by intellectual disability and growth retardation. In cancers the functional connection of EZH2 with proteins like VHL (Von Hippel-Lindau tumor suppressor) can contribute to oncogenic processes by impacting pathways critical to cell cycle regulation and apoptosis suppression.
